Claims (30)
- 화소에 포토센서가 설치된 터치 패널의 구동방법으로서,복수의 화소를 포함하는 표시장치에 화상을 표시하는 단계와,상기 화상이 표시된 상태에서 피검출물에 의해 반사된 빛을 검출함으로써 검출 영역을 결정하는 단계와,상기 검출 영역에 있어서의 화소들의 계조를 같게 하면서 상기 피검출물을 판독하는 단계를 포함하는 터치 패널의 구동방법.
- 제 1항에 있어서,상기 판독을 행하는 동안 상기 검출 영역에 있어서의 화소들에 공급되는 비디오 신호가 서로 같은 터치 패널의 구동방법.
- 제 1항에 있어서,상기 검출 영역 외부에 설치된 포토센서에 접속된 박막 트랜지스터가 오프되는 터치 패널의 구동방법.
- 제 1항에 기재된 터치 패널 구동방법에 의해 동작하는 터치 패널.
- 제 4항에 있어서,동일한 색을 발광하는 상기 복수의 화소가 서로 어긋난 위치에 배치된 터치 패널.
- 제 4항에 있어서,상기 복수의 화소가 델타 배열로 배치되어 있는 터치 패널.
- 제 4항에 있어서,상기 표시장치가 액정표시장치인 터치 패널.
- 제 7항에 있어서,상기 액정표시장치의 백라이트로서 냉음극관을 사용하는 터치 패널.
- 제 7항에 있어서,상기 액정표시장치의 백라이트로서 백색의 발광 다이오드를 사용하는 터치 패널.
- 제 7항에 있어서,상기 액정표시장치의 액정층이 블루상을 발현하는 액정을 포함하는 터치 패널.
- 화소에 포토센서가 설치된 터치 패널의 구동방법으로서,복수의 화소를 포함하는 표시장치에 화상을 표시하는 단계와,상기 화상이 표시된 상태에서 피검출물에 의해 반사된 빛을 검출함으로써 검출 영역을 결정하는 단계와,상기 검출 영역에 있어서의 화소들의 계조를 상기 검출 영역에 있는 화소들 중에서 가장 밝은 화소의 계조와 같게 하면서 상기 피검출물을 판독하는 단계를 포함하는 터치 패널의 구동방법.
- 제 11항에 있어서,상기 판독을 행하는 동안 상기 검출 영역에 있어서의 화소들에 공급되는 비디오 신호가 서로 같은 터치 패널의 구동방법.
- 제 11항에 있어서,상기 검출 영역 외부에 설치된 포토센서에 접속된 박막 트랜지스터가 오프되는 터치 패널의 구동방법.
- 제 11항에 기재된 터치 패널 구동방법에 의해 동작하는 터치 패널.
- 제 14항에 있어서,동일한 색을 발광하는 상기 복수의 화소가 서로 어긋난 위치에 배치된 터치 패널.
- 제 14항에 있어서,상기 복수의 화소가 델타 배열로 배치되어 있는 터치 패널.
- 제 14항에 있어서,상기 표시장치가 액정표시장치인 터치 패널.
- 제 17항에 있어서,상기 액정표시장치의 백라이트로서 냉음극관을 사용하는 터치 패널.
- 제 17항에 있어서,상기 액정표시장치의 백라이트로서 백색의 발광 다이오드를 사용하는 터치 패널.
- 제 17항에 있어서,상기 액정표시장치의 액정층이 블루상을 발현하는 액정을 포함하는 터치 패널.
- 화소에 포토센서가 설치된 터치 패널의 구동방법으로서,복수의 화소를 포함하는 표시장치에 화상을 표시하는 단계와,상기 화상이 표시된 상태에서 피검출물에 의해 반사된 빛을 검출함으로써 검출 영역을 결정하는 단계와,상기 검출 영역에서 백 표시를 행하면서 상기 피검출물을 판독하는 단계를 포함하는 터치 패널의 구동방법.
- 제 21항에 있어서,상기 판독을 행하는 동안 상기 검출 영역에 있어서의 화소들에 공급되는 비디오 신호가 서로 같은 터치 패널의 구동방법.
- 제 21항에 있어서,상기 검출 영역 외부에 설치된 포토센서에 접속된 박막 트랜지스터가 오프되는 터치 패널의 구동방법.
- 제 21항에 기재된 터치 패널 구동방법에 의해 동작하는 터치 패널.
- 제 24항에 있어서,동일한 색을 발광하는 상기 복수의 화소가 서로 어긋난 위치에 배치된 터치 패널.
- 제 24항에 있어서,상기 복수의 화소가 델타 배열로 배치되어 있는 터치 패널.
- 제 24항에 있어서,상기 표시장치가 액정표시장치인 터치 패널.
- 제 27항에 있어서,상기 액정표시장치의 백라이트로서 냉음극관을 사용하는 터치 패널.
- 제 27항에 있어서,상기 액정표시장치의 백라이트로서 백색의 발광 다이오드를 사용하는 터치 패널.
- 제 27항에 있어서,상기 액정표시장치의 액정층이 블루상을 발현하는 액정을 포함하는 터치 패널.
